problemscpp
A collection of my answers to algorithm problems in c++.
静态 Public 成员函数 | 所有成员列表
leetcode::most_frequent_number_following_key_in_an_array::Solution类 参考

#include <leetcode.h>

静态 Public 成员函数

static int mostFrequent (vector< int > &nums, int key)
 

详细描述

在文件 leetcode.h1469 行定义.

成员函数说明

◆ mostFrequent()

int leetcode::most_frequent_number_following_key_in_an_array::Solution::mostFrequent ( vector< int > &  nums,
int  key 
)
static

在文件 leetcode.cpp3818 行定义.

3818 {
3819 unordered_map<int, int> um;
3820 for(int i = 0; i + 1 < nums.size(); i++) {
3821 if(nums[i] == key) {
3822 um[nums[i + 1]]++;
3823 }
3824 }
3825 int max_v = 0;
3826 int max_k = 0;
3827 for(auto [k, v]: um) {
3828 if(v > max_v) {
3829 max_v = v;
3830 max_k = k;
3831 }
3832 }
3833 return max_k;
3834 }

被这些函数引用 leetcode::most_frequent_number_following_key_in_an_array::TEST().


该类的文档由以下文件生成: